Goshen to assume sewer assets from Amy’s; board to finalize funding plan and legal review
Summary
Board discussed acquiring Echo Lake sewer assets from Amy’s with an asset purchase price of $1,500,000 paid over time. Members said assets and warranties will transfer to the town; details on funding, indemnity and the contract exhibits will be developed with outside counsel (Allison) and returned for approval within 30–45 days.
